A Prayer for Family Unity During Christmas

Christmas Prayers for Families

Dear God,
Thank You for bringing our family together in this special season. In a busy world, moments like this are precious.

Help us stay united, not just today but every day. When misunderstandings happen, give us patience and understanding. Teach us to listen with open hearts and speak with kindness.

Let our home be filled with love, respect, and support. Strengthen the bond we share so we can face life together.

Thank You for the gift of family.
Amen.

Heavenly Father,
As we celebrate Christmas, we ask for peace in our home. Life can bring stress and worries, but in this moment, we turn to You.

Calm our thoughts and ease any tension between us. Replace anger with patience and silence with understanding. Let every corner of our home feel safe and peaceful.

May Your presence bring a quiet calm that stays with us beyond this day.

Amen.


A Prayer of Gratitude for Family Blessings

Dear Lord,
Today we pause to say thank You. Thank You for the love we share, the meals we enjoy, and the time we spend together.

Sometimes we forget how blessed we are. Help us see the beauty in simple moments. Let our hearts stay full of gratitude and appreciation.

Teach us to value each other and not take these moments for granted.

Amen.


A Prayer for Protection and Safety

Dear God,
We ask for Your protection over our family this Christmas. Watch over each one of us wherever we go.

Keep us safe from harm and guide us in our daily lives. Surround our home with Your care and light.

Let us feel secure knowing You are always near, watching over us with love.

Amen.


A Prayer for Joy and Happiness

Heavenly Father,
Fill our home with true joy this Christmas. Not just laughter, but a deep happiness that comes from being together.

Help us create memories that stay in our hearts for years to come. Let smiles replace worries and warmth fill every moment.

May this joy continue even after the season ends.

Amen.


A Prayer for Strength as a Family

Dear Lord,
Life is not always easy. There are moments when we feel tired, confused, or weak. In those times, please give our family strength.

Help us support each other and stand together during challenges. Remind us that we do not have to face anything alone.

Give us courage, patience, and faith to move forward.

Amen.


A Prayer for Love and Kindness at Christmas

Dear God,
Teach us to love one another deeply. Help us show kindness in our words and actions.

Let our home be a place where everyone feels valued and respected. Remove harsh words and replace them with gentle ones.

Fill our hearts with compassion, care, and understanding. Let Your love guide everything we do.

Amen.


A Prayer for Forgiveness and Healing

Heavenly Father,
Christmas is a time for new beginnings. If there is any hurt or misunderstanding between us, help us forgive.

Soften our hearts and remove any anger we hold inside. Give us the courage to say sorry and the strength to move forward.

Let healing begin in our family today.

Amen.


A Prayer for Guidance in the New Year

Dear Lord,
As we celebrate Christmas, we also look ahead to the future. Please guide our family in the coming year.

Help us make wise decisions and walk on the right path. Keep us focused on what truly matters.

Let Your wisdom lead us in every step we take.

Amen.


A Prayer for Lasting Family Bonds

Christmas Prayers for Families

Dear God,
Time passes quickly, but we ask that our bond as a family remains strong.

Help us stay connected even when life becomes busy. Remind us to check on each other, support one another, and stay close.

Let love be the foundation of our relationship, now and always.

Amen.
